Transaction 159e30c3cf70c94e4877b4b35ead85c9c668f9515104f7b79c39a2bda405dd1e

30 Input
2 Outputs
  • 159e30c3cf70c94e4877b4b35ead85c9c668f9515104f7b79c39a2bda405dd1e:0
  • value  7951
    address  bc1qf0ucgx8muvxtaxzjwfqu55jt4y4e5nv9r96zfaar583d60fm3mqqdhf429
  • 159e30c3cf70c94e4877b4b35ead85c9c668f9515104f7b79c39a2bda405dd1e:1
  • value  677086
    address  3Q8CRfqPo7uSbKWy8kp3G2NVywusryvxwH